Dr Thomas,good morning Dr. that's a steep wish list in a technician, CDT/MDT or otherwise. basically you're asking for a singular tech that knows all aspects of every technical dept, save ortho. or 3 techs at minimum. these types generally own their own labs (myself and many others here). i wish you luck in finding this person but will toss out a caveat for what the price tag should be for someone of this caliber....and that's well north of 6 figures. should you have success in finding someone this skilled that comes aboard, please stay in touch with us all here on the forums. we enjoy it when docs want to join our mad house! haha

Ummmmm, no. It doesn’t work that way. Ever. Money is a very short term motivator. It does not create passion. You can’t buy love, and you can’t buy passion either. I know other lab owners with less qualifications than me who make way more than me because they do implants only, or they have more techs doing average work. I prefer just me doing it all, doing it my way to my standards for my prosthodontic docs and a couple of general docs. I certainly make six figures but it’s not money that motivates me.
